Playing on some older (Mostly North Africa maps), I realized that most people on the server feel like "ugh, not this map again" and leave the server once the map comes up. Some maps seem to have lost their appeal to the players compared to the newer Western and Eastern front maps.
The FH2 mappers have obviously improved themselves as they gained more experienced so the older maps lack some cosmetic features. Some things that come to my mind initially is well distributed grass, stones and detailed rubble, etc... Not to mention that older maps have vanilla BF2 statics in them (like BF2 sandbags and buildings) which are obviously of lower quality compared to the later ones made by FH2 developers.
As far as I remember, a few updates ago Bardia received a facelift. It seems that mostly cosmetic changes have been made like lighting and the skybox (the images on FH2 website belong to the old version, you can compare the current version to it) and even this had drastically recovered Bardia's popularity among players. Less people leaving the server, less complaints in the chat.
And I think it is appropriate to state that one of the things that make FH2 still popular is its high quality content, which some of these maps fail to match cosmetically in my opinion.
